Why Ostomy Belts Matter

There are several ways in which an ostomy belt can make a difference for an ostomate:

  • Additional stabilization for baseplates/barriers: Belts assist in securing the barrier more firmly against your body. This is especially helpful when using convex barriers or where the skin surface is irregular or rounded.
  • Preventing leaks and comfort while being active: Activity, movement, bending, or even just normal daily motion tends to pull or tug on the barrier. A good-fitting belt distributes forces, minimizes the chances of leaks, and can stop irritation caused by motion.

Who benefits:

  • Users whose body contours make securing and sealing difficult (rounded abdomen, folds, concave areas).
  • Anyone wanting extra confidence in situations with more movement, like exercise, work, or outdoor activities.

Brava Belt (Standard)

The Brava Ostomy Belt (Standard) (Product code: 00421) is a trusted solution for many ostomy users worldwide. It is designed to provide stability and reassurance without compromising comfort.

Key Features

  • The standard Brava Belt is made of soft, comfortable material and is designed to be discreet under clothing.
  • It is elastic and adjustable to help you find a snug yet comfortable fit.
  • Available in standard size to match waist or hip measurements.
  • Fits all SenSura and Alterna barriers that have two belt hooks.

Benefits

  • Good for everyday use: walking, light activity, or general movement where barrier security might otherwise be a concern.
  • Helps with adhesion and stability, especially when the abdominal surface is not flat.
  • Because it’s designed to be discreet, many users find it comfortable under clothing without bulkiness.

Brava Belt for SenSura Mio

This Brava Belt for SenSura Mio (Product Code: 00423, 00424) is designed specifically for SenSura Mio Appliances.

  • This belt is made to work with SenSura Mio barriers that have built-in belt tabs, including both flat and convex baseplates.
  • It has four belt hooks, which help distribute pressure more evenly across the barrier, adding stability.

Sizes (Standard and XL)

  • Comes in two size options: the standard size and an XL size for those who need extended length.
  • The larger size helps accommodate larger waist or hip measurements, or for those who prefer less tight compression.

Comfort-Focused Design

  • Neutral-gray color for discretion under clothing.
  • Soft, cloth-covered adjustment tab so it won’t dig in.
  • Comfortable elastic material for flexibility and wearability.

Who it’s Best Suited For

  • Users of SenSura Mio one-piece or two-piece systems with built-in belt tabs.
  • Particularly beneficial if using convex barriers, since the belt helps pull the convex barrier closer to the body, minimizing gaps and improving the seal. This makes it one of the best ostomy belts for SenSura Mio

How to Decide Which Belt is Right for You

Choosing between the Brava Ostomy Belt (Standard) and the Brava Belt for SenSura Mio really comes down to your appliance, your body, and your lifestyle.

  • Your ostomy system: If you’re using a SenSura Mio appliance with built-in belt tabs, go for the Brava Belt for SenSura Mio. If you use a SenSura (non-Mio) or Alterna system, the Brava Ostomy Belt (Standard) is better.
  • Your body shape: For people with a larger waist or a rounded abdomen, the XL size of either belt usually feels more comfortable. If your waist is smaller or average, the standard size should work well.
  • Your barrier type: If you use a convex barrier, you’ll likely benefit from the extra stability of the Brava Belt for SenSura Mio, which is specially designed to hold convex barriers more securely.
  • Your activity level: If you’re active, exercise often, or do a lot of bending and stretching, the Mio belt with four hooks can give you extra confidence. For lighter daily routines, the standard belt is usually enough support.
  • Your clothing and comfort needs: Both belts are made to be discreet and comfortable under clothes.
